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How do I know if my door latch assembly needs replacement?

A: If your refrigerator door won't stay closed, latches intermittently, or feels loose when you close it, the latch assembly likely needs replacement. A broken latch can cause your fridge to open while driving, leading to food spoilage and temperature loss.
